The Pressure Oxidation Technician at NPL is critical to the safe and efficient operation of the Pressure Oxidation (POX) circuit within the mineral processing plant in Papua New Guinea. This role ensures the POX process is maintained within approved parameters to meet production targets while prioritising safety, environmental compliance, equipment reliability, and product quality.
The Technician will collaborate closely with Control Room Operators, Maintenance, Metallurgy, Laboratory, and Process Engineering teams to identify and resolve operational issues, support continuous improvement initiatives, and optimise plant performance.

- Operate and monitor the POX circuit per approved procedures.
- Monitor autoclave conditions including pressure, temperature, slurry density, flow rates, residence time, oxygen levels, and other critical parameters.
- Inspect autoclaves, flash vessels, pumps, valves, piping, heat exchangers, agitators, oxygen systems, and associated equipment routinely.
- Monitor slurry transfer and process flow through the circuit.
- Identify and address abnormal conditions such as pressure fluctuations, blockages, leaks, vibration, abnormal noises, pump issues, or instability.
- Assist with start-up, shutdown, changeover, plant isolation, and emergency response procedures.
- Maintain accurate operational records, logs, and shift reports.
- Communicate operating status and any issues during shift handovers.
